Anchorage Daily News December 19, 1998

Palmer resident Shirley Rae Blakely, 59, died Dec. 15, 1998, at Valley Hospital. Visitation was at Kehl's Palmer Mortuary Chapel. A funeral was at Kehl's Palmer Mortuary Chapel. Burial followed at Palmer Pioneer Cemetery.

Mrs. Blakely was born March 2, 1939, in Fenwick, W.Va. She attended high school in West Virginia, college through the Navy, and took several courses in Redding, Calif. She served in the U.S. Navy from 1957 to 1960 and came to Alaska from Redding in 1982. She had managed the Glacier View and Palmer Tesoros. Her family said: ''Mrs. Blakely worked for Fisher's Fuel for several years. She enjoyed her work and loved all her co-workers like her own children. She loved to fish and camp and spent most of her summer days off camping with her fishing pole, family and her dog, Thumper, by her side. She loved people and shared her love with those around her. Her love for her children and grandchildren showed in everything she did. She was their support, their teacher and their best friend. She was a part of her grandkids' life in all aspects and was there to raise her granddaughters, Tifani and Ashlea, through the rough times. She will be missed more than words can express. ''She joins her mother, Olive, and brother, Larry, with God.'' Mrs. Blakely enjoyed taking care of her parrots, Michael and Chico, and spending her extra time with her kids and grandkids.

She is survived by her daughter and son-in-law, Renee' Blakely and Mark Loomis; sons and daughters-in-law, Bill and Carol Blakely, and Mace Blakely and Becky Ling; grandchildren, Tifani, Ashlea, Keenan, Trisha, Traci, Shanna, Branden, Brianna and Cole Blakely, and Rosanna Loomis; brother, Charlie Thomas of Ohio; aunt, Sylvia Bolling of Indiana; and many nieces, nephews and cousins.
